Output 3d8f7b6ba4c954087487012d02977107c049407217fdcc761f15043c5f8f0468:1

value
1529564639
script pubkey
OP_0 OP_PUSHBYTES_20 d7ae994c24f86c78964c6ed9bd9efb04f37b879d
address
ltc1q67hfjnpylpk839jvdmvmm8hmqnehhpuay360sa
transaction
3d8f7b6ba4c954087487012d02977107c049407217fdcc761f15043c5f8f0468
spent
true